How To Choose The Best Wheel Stud Pattern Tool

Your first decision depends on the job you need to do. A quick bolt-pattern check at a swap meet needs a different tool than mocking up an entire custom wheel setup in your garage. These three specs separate the right fit from the wrong one.

Template vs. Adjustable Caliper

Fixed templates — disc-shaped guides with cutouts for 4, 5, and 6 lugs — are the fastest option. You place one against the wheel’s bolt holes, and the pattern is right there in the cutout. That gives you an instant answer. Adjustable sliding calipers work like a ruler with moving arms: you slide the arms until they sit over opposite studs and read the metric or imperial scale. Templates are instant and very reliable for common patterns. Calipers cover a wider range, including rare or 8-lug patterns, but you must line the tool up correctly each time, which takes a little more care.

Material: Plastic vs. Steel

Nearly every budget and mid-range tool is made from high-impact ABS plastic (a tough, impact-resistant plastic that resists cracking). That is fine for occasional use — a plastic template is light, will not rust, and fits easily in a glove box. Steel tools, like the simulators at the premium end, are laser-cut from 10-gauge (roughly 3.5mm thick) sheet metal. They are much heavier and more rigid. A steel tool can support the weight of a tire and wheel assembly while you check brake-caliper clearance. If you only need to measure a bolt pattern, plastic saves weight and money. If you need to test-fit a whole wheel, you need steel.

Which Lug Patterns and Vehicle Types You Work With

Most tools cover 4, 5, and 6 lugs for passenger cars, trucks, and SUVs. Some also handle 8-lug patterns for heavy-duty trucks and trailers. Check the included bolt circles — a list like 5×100, 5×112, and 5×114.3 tells you the tool was designed with modern vehicles in mind. If you work on classic cars or European imports, look for metric patterns (mm) and SAE patterns (inches, the standard used on American vehicles) printed on the scale. Dual-scale tools remove the mental unit conversion and reduce errors.

Understanding the Specs

Pitch Circle Diameter (PCD)

This number tells you the diameter, in millimeters or inches, of the imaginary circle that passes through the center of each lug hole. Common examples are 5×114.3mm (many Honda and Nissan vehicles) and 5×4.75″ (some older GM trucks). A tool that prints both SAE (inches) and Metric (mm) scales lets you measure any wheel without converting units in your head — just line up the gauge and read whichever scale matches your vehicle’s spec sheet.

Fixed Template vs. Adjustable Caliper

A fixed template has specific cutouts for common bolt circles. You place it on the studs and the correct pattern is obvious. This is the fastest method but limited to the patterns the manufacturer chose to cut. An adjustable caliper spans a wider range of patterns in a single tool, but you must slide the arms to the correct stud positions yourself. The caliper is more versatile; the template is more simple to use for the patterns it covers. Choose by how many different lug counts you encounter.

FAQ

How do I use a wheel stud pattern tool on a car with the wheel still mounted?
You cannot use a template or caliper directly on mounted studs because the wheel covers them. Remove the wheel and place the tool against the exposed brake rotor or hub studs. For a quick on-car check, measure the distance between two adjacent studs (center-to-center) on the uncovered hub using a ruler, then multiply by 1.155 for 5-lug or refer to a bolt-pattern conversion chart.
What is the difference between 5×114.3mm and 5×4.5 inches?
They are the same physical dimension. 5×114.3mm is the metric expression of 5×4.5 inches (114.3 millimeters equals 4.5 inches). Many Japanese and Korean cars list the pattern in millimeters while American vehicles use inches. A dual-scale tool shows both so there is no math or confusion.
Can I use a 5-lug template on a 6-lug wheel?
No. The template cutouts are specific to the lug count. A 5-lug template has five slots at specific angles; it will not align with the six bolts of a 6-lug wheel. You need a dedicated 6-lug template or a multi-pattern set (like the AOQIVIS or eaacaa kits above) that includes separate guides for 4, 5, and 6 lugs.
Why do some tools weigh 1.6 ounces and others weigh 7 pounds?
Weight tells you the tool’s job. Plastic templates (1.6–9.6 ounces) are for measuring the bolt circle only — you hold them to the studs to confirm the pattern. Steel simulators (6.5–7 pounds) are for mocking up an entire wheel and tire assembly; their weight comes from the rigid steel frame that supports the rubber, checks suspension clearance, and measures backspacing accurately. They are not interchangeable.
Will a sliding caliper work on wheels that already have brake rotors installed?
Yes. A sliding caliper (like the FIRSTINFO or Kingdder) is placed over the exposed studs on the hub or brake rotor. The arms slide outward until they contact the studs, and you read the PCD from the scale. It works with rotors and drums as long as the studs are accessible and the tool clears the center hub.
Do any of these tools measure offset or backspacing?
The plastic templates and sliding calipers in this guide measure bolt pattern only — they do not tell you offset or backspacing. The steel simulators (Speedway Motors WheelWise and the maXpeedingrods unit) are designed for full mock-up, so they let you measure both backspacing (distance from the mounting surface to the wheel’s inner edge) and clearance to suspension components.
How long does a plastic wheel stud pattern tool last?
Plenty of years for a home garage tool. High-impact ABS plastic resists cracking from occasional drops and is unaffected by oil or brake cleaner. The main failure mode is the scale markings wearing off after repeated scrubbing. A light paint marker refresh restores readability. Commercial shop use would favor a steel caliper like the FIRSTINFO for longer scale life.
Can I identify a wheel bolt pattern with just a tape measure?
You can, but it is slower and more error-prone. For a 4-lug wheel, measure from the center of one stud straight across to the center of the opposite stud. For 5-lug wheels, you measure from the outer edge of one stud to the center of the stud two steps away — then consult a conversion chart. A dedicated tool eliminates the chart lookup and the measurement-inaccuracy risk, especially on patterns that are only 2.3mm apart (like 5x112mm vs 5×114.3mm).
Are all plastic bolt pattern tools the same quality?
No. The difference is in mold precision and material grade. Higher-quality tools use high-impact ABS that resists warping and maintains dimensional accuracy over years. Cheaper tools may use recycled plastic that feels greasy or has flash (excess plastic) around the cutouts, reducing fit accuracy. The AOQIVIS and JEGS tools on this list are known for clean mold work; budget generic tools from unknown brands are a gamble on precision.
What if my vehicle has an unusual bolt pattern not on the gauge?
A sliding caliper is your best bet here. Because it is adjustable, it can measure any PCD within its range — even patterns that do not appear on a fixed template. Measure two opposite or skipped studs, read the scale, and you have the exact pattern regardless of whether the manufacturer planned for it. This is why shops that see a wide variety of vehicles (European, classic, commercial) prefer a caliper over templates.
